Menu Close

Software Engineers as well as the Role They will Play

Software executive refers to the systematic implementation of various computer engineering methods into the development and design of software devices. Software system has become a major part of any kind of organisation as it helps in the production of high quality, cost-effective and trustworthy software systems for different applications and tasks. Software engineering includes the field of software anatomist, software structures and program testing.

Application engineers happen to be professionals who also work on software projects, usually for software companies. Software engineers are required to create software systems which can be used by different departments and will satisfy the requirements of their clients.

The basic position of a computer software engineer is usually to define the scope on the software system. As being a developer, he or she must write the code for the project. This is very difficult, mainly because it requires a lots of knowledge and experience. Furthermore to authoring the code, the software engineer also needs to guarantee which the system is user-friendly. The programmer has to help to make certain the user can readily understand and use the system without any technological difficulties.

Once the software technical engineers have crafted and examined the software program, they must test that to get bugs and defects. The most frequent problem which the software engineers facial area during the examining process is the incompatibility amongst the software system and the operating system of your machine the reason is developed in.

During the evaluating process, computer software engineers check whether the computer software works well on a variety of systems. This helps them to test more than one edition of the computer software at a time, therefore ensuring that the solution is compatible while using the operating system it can easily be tested on.

Most companies require program systems to be developed uptipps.com within a brief time. The development of such a system quite often requires a crew of software technicians. This staff consists of the technology programmer, a great analyst, an application test industrial engineer, a system trendy and a course manager.

An application system is designed so that it can fulfill the requirements belonging to the users. Additionally, it ensures that the technology will not only manage to fulfill its original purpose yet also deliver useful results to its users.

Many businesses require software program systems to fulfill the difficulties of their competitors, but simultaneously keep the rates at just a little low. Computer software systems are designed to run efficiently and necessarily to use a lot of memory, electricity and energy.

Corporations are also creating an online business in order to improve computer networks and increase productivity. Software program engineers design and style computer sites that can support this phenomena.

Some of the careers that a software systems professional does include designing a web web browser, creating a search results, developing graphics software program and making software that supports the development of database program. These careers require a number of creativity and computer skills.

Computer software engineers must have a lot of patience and ability to use others. They need to be able to deal with problems that may arise during the development process and solve challenges quickly. This is the reason why software designers often help with other pros like the coders.

Software engineers can choose to work in software program development, processing, design, mlm, or sales. It is always much better work with firms that are experts in specific areas.

The wage that a software engineer earns depends on many elements like the competence he/she comes with, the company he works for the purpose of, experience he/she has as well as the length of time that he/she works in the firm. The highest salary will be earned by simply those who work in the discipline of software architectural.

Leave a Reply

Your email address will not be published. Required fields are marked *